Q

Circular flow diagram

A

Show the flow of the goods and services, factors of production, and monetary payments

8
Q

Production Possibilities Frontier

A

Shows the combinations of outputs an economy can posisbly produce with the available factors of production.

11
Q

Microeconomics

A

Study of how households and firms make decisions and how they interact in specifc markets.

12
Q

Macroeconomics

A

Study of economy-wide phenomena such as the federal deficit, the rate of unemppoyment and policies to improvve our standard of living.

13
Q

Positive statement

A

Describe the world as it is. Can be confirmed or refuted with evidence. Descriptive

14
Q

Normative Statement

A

Describe how the world ought to be. Involves values and facts. Prescriptive
